Hays wins contract with France Telecom

Hays Logistics has signed a Euro 12m contract with France Telecom that further strengthens the supply chain specialists leading position in the European mobile phone market.
The contract involves 7 sites across Britain, Benelux and France, handling the fulfilment and assembly of up to 16m phones, together with the return of £2.5m phones and management of 4m support calls.
Hays 3 year contract is with a subdivision of France Telecom, France Telecom Terminaux, which is principally involved with the purchasing and distribution of Orange mobile phones.
